12 oz bottle at Paté Paté, Copenhagen. Copper color. Strong fresh citrus and pine aroma. Tart, citrusy and piney flavor with minerally bitterness in finish. Good fresh hop-forward pale ale.

On tap at APEX, pours a pretty clear golden with a small white head. Aroma of floral hops, resin and light caramel / crackery malt - not as pungent as an IPA, but more so than your average pale ale. Flavour of floral hops, herbal notes and crackery malts. Nearly an IPA, a nicely hopped .pale ale. Very nice refresher, though the New Dogtown is superior.
